Annotatsiya. Ushbu maqolada antibiotik rezistentlikning global sog‘liqni
saqlash tizimidagi o‘rni, uning paydo bo‘lish sabablari, molekulyar mexanizmlari va
klinik ahamiyati keng yoritilgan. Antibiotiklardan noto‘g‘ri va nazoratsiz foydalanish
natijasida mikroorganizmlarning chidamliligi ortib borayotgani tahlil qilinadi.
Shuningdek, rezistentlikni kamaytirish va nazorat qilishning zamonaviy strategiyalari
ko‘rib chiqilgan. Antibiotiklar XX asrning eng muhim tibbiy kashfiyotlaridan biri
bo‘lib, ko‘plab yuqumli kasalliklarni samarali davolash imkonini berdi.
Biroq, so‘nggi yillarda antibiotik rezistentlik muammosi global miqyosda
keskinlashib bormoqda. Jahon sog‘liqni saqlash tashkiloti ma’lumotlariga ko‘ra,
antibiotiklarga chidamli infeksiyalar yiliga millionlab insonlar hayotiga xavf
tug‘dirmoqda. Rezistentlikning oshishi nafaqat infeksion kasalliklarni davolashni
qiyinlashtiradi, balki jarrohlik operatsiyalari, transplantatsiya va onkologik davolash
samaradorligiga ham salbiy ta’sir ko‘rsatadi.
